Head of Finance

Posted by Atkinson Moss.

We are working with a local charity in the heart of Norwich in their search for a Head of Finance for approx. 12 months. Responsibilities will be centred around managing the Trust's financial resources and ensuring compliance with financial and statutory obligations. The position requires strong leadership, financial management, system development, and collaboration skills to support the organization in achieving its goals.

Main Duties:

  • Lead and develop the Finance team to provide high-quality support across the organization.
  • Develop accounting systems and processes for robust financial reporting and decision-making.
  • Ensure proper recording and accounting of income and expenditure in compliance with policies and regulations.
  • Maintain strong and effective financial controls within the organization.
  • Provide timely and accurate financial information, including income, expenditure, balance sheets, and cash flow.
  • Oversee the year-end process, including preparation of statutory financial statements and managing audits.
  • Manage day-to-day banking and ensure effective cash flow planning.
  • Ensure effective tracking of income and expenditure for grants, projects, and restricted funds.
  • Assist in long-term financial planning for the trust and its subsidiaries.
  • Oversee and support the production of detailed annual budgets and forecasts.
  • Develop and produce accurate and timely monthly reports.
  • Ensure proper accounting for capital and fixed assets.
  • Foster continuous improvement within the finance function.
  • Stay updated on financial legislation and regulations affecting the charity sector.
  • Perform additional duties and projects as agreed with the Director of Finance and Support Services.
